Output 15d4b1a425bfab4db5c0725320595ae5e1c8e7f8ee44c8b53cee3d4716fa382a:16

value
3443381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dff222dd5aab45f5444515641ccf58dd9f6b79aa OP_EQUAL
address
3N78gEqVJXVAqHGPAumWokDVcQ6aaHybPL
transaction
15d4b1a425bfab4db5c0725320595ae5e1c8e7f8ee44c8b53cee3d4716fa382a
spent
true